Entrepreneurship is often depicted as a solo journey with long hours, personal sacrifice, and tough decision‑making on your own. While grit and determination are essential, no entrepreneur truly elevates alone. The team, network, and community that surround you don’t just support your business—they shape your success.



Here’s why building a power team and cultivating a strong entrepreneurial community is one of the most strategic things you can do.


💫Your Network Shapes Your Opportunities and Growth


One of the biggest advantages a business owner can have is access to the right people at the right time.


📌 According to research cited by Forbes, 78% of startups say networking is vital to entrepreneurial success, influencing everything from funding to partnerships, client referrals, and innovation.


📌 In fact, one UK study found that 93% of SME owners say their professional network directly led to new business leads—and 75% regard those connections as essential to growth.


When you’re connected to a strong network:

✨You find more leads

✨You secure partnerships faster

✨You access insights you might never gain alone


A strong network doesn’t just give you resources—it creates opportunities that wouldn’t exist otherwise.


💫 A Power Team Lets You Operate in Your ‘Zone of Genius’


Entrepreneurs who elevate know they can’t do everything themselves. A power team—made up of colleagues, advisors, collaborators, and specialists enables you to focus on what only you can do.


Working with a team:


✨Doubles your capacity

✨Brings diverse skills and perspectives

✨Speeds up execution


Harvard research supports the idea that professional connections and collaborative environments improve business outcomes by expanding access to resources, insights, and expertise that single founders often overlook.


Whether it’s an in‑house team, contractor ecosystem, or advisory circle, the people who build with you matter as much as the ideas you pursue.


💫Community Enhances Resilience and Confidence


Entrepreneurship can be isolating. Without encouragement, setbacks can feel like failures and challenges can feel insurmountable. That’s where community plays a crucial role.


When you’re part of a supportive entrepreneurial ecosystem:


✨You get shared experiences and lived wisdom

✨Mentorship becomes practical, not theoretical

✨Accountability keeps you moving forward


Oxford research in business and organizational studies shows that entrepreneurial activity is strongly facilitated by the social ties connecting founders to broader networks of actors—helping them navigate uncertainty more effectively and access dynamic capabilities they wouldn’t build alone.


Your network isn’t just “nice to have” it is strategic infrastructure for growth. So many people say ‘your network is your net worth ’ it is about spending time with like minded people that have a positive growth mindset.


💫 Strategic Networking Boosts Credibility and Visibility


In today’s relationship‑driven business landscape, who knows you matters.


📌 A Harvard study highlights that a large majority of professionals recognise the importance of networking for career and business success, with networking playing a key role in accessing opportunities, mentorship, and visibility for entrepreneurs.


A strong community amplifies:


👉🏼Your reputation

👉🏼Your credibility

👉🏼Your reach


People trust what is familiar—and your network helps make you familiar.


📌91% of consumers are likely to buy from a brand that takes action to gain their trust, and 89-92% trust recommendations from people they know over advertisements. It takes roughly 27 interactions to build this level of loyalty. 


📌Edelman Trust Barometer says 63% of consumers will buy new products from a trusted brand, even if they are more expensive than a non-trusted one. And 55% will stay loyal, even if the brand makes a mistake. This proves how important it is for your business to invest in your consumers.


💫The Right Connections Bring Faster Learning & Better Decisions


A good network also accelerates learning. In fact, purpose‑driven networking (where you connect with intention and mutual value) can improve decision‑making and outcomes because you get access to insights and experiences outside your immediate circle.


Surrounding yourself with diverse perspectives—from mentors to collaborators helps you:


✨Spot trends sooner

✨Avoid costly mistakes

✨Innovate with confidence


A mission‑driven team and network become informal advisors that challenge you to evolve.


Elevating as an entrepreneur isn’t just about refining your product or improving your strategy. It’s about who you build with and who builds with you.


Your power team, your professional network, and your community don’t just support your business—they elevate it.
